From 386c747e06fa1966b9ebb05004cef281bd62dbb9 Mon Sep 17 00:00:00 2001 From: Anthony Calosa Date: Wed, 20 Jul 2022 17:34:25 +0800 Subject: [PATCH] Update DestroyEffect.java --- .../main/java/forge/game/ability/effects/DestroyEffect.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/forge-game/src/main/java/forge/game/ability/effects/DestroyEffect.java b/forge-game/src/main/java/forge/game/ability/effects/DestroyEffect.java index 2ec6aa03fad..e093887729b 100644 --- a/forge-game/src/main/java/forge/game/ability/effects/DestroyEffect.java +++ b/forge-game/src/main/java/forge/game/ability/effects/DestroyEffect.java @@ -119,6 +119,7 @@ public class DestroyEffect extends SpellAbilityEffect { final boolean remAttached = sa.hasParam("RememberAttached"); final boolean noRegen = sa.hasParam("NoRegen"); final boolean sac = sa.hasParam("Sacrifice"); + final boolean alwaysRem = sa.hasParam("AlwaysRemember"); boolean destroyed = false; final Card lki = CardUtil.getLKICopy(gameCard, cachedMap); @@ -133,7 +134,7 @@ public class DestroyEffect extends SpellAbilityEffect { if (destroyed && remDestroyed) { card.addRemembered(gameCard); } - if (destroyed && sa.hasParam("RememberLKI")) { + if ((destroyed || alwaysRem) && sa.hasParam("RememberLKI")) card.addRemembered(lki); } }